The principles of science related to cybersecurity are Objectivity, Ethical neutrality, and Parsimony. Objectivity offers an impartial view on research subjects. It helps clarify cyber-crimes by limiting personal views as applied to the real objective. Ethical neutrality has to be considered for some information to promote confidentiality, which is required to be upheld. Parsimony provides a simple and concise perspective on what experts portray to others unfamiliar with the field. It is crucial for any type of research to be done by the principles of science as it pertains to Cyber—this is a growing field, and the principles provide a deeper understanding on how to handle new issues as they develop.
